Dr. Gregory M. Enns has specialized experience in the fields of Clinical Biochemical Genetics, Pediatrics, and Medical Genetics (M.D.). They earned their BA in Biology from Pomona College and their MB BCh from the University of Glasgow. After completing their residency in Medicine at Glasgow Royal Infirmary, they went on to complete a fellowship in Medical Genetics at the University of California, San Francisco. Today, the expert holds certifications in Clinical Genetics and Genomics and Clinical Biochemical Genetics. Previously, they held roles as an Associate Professor, Program Director, and Associate Program Director at Stanford University School of Medicine. Currently, they work as a Physician and Director at Stanford Medicine Children's Health and Clinical Instructor at the University of California, San Francisco.
